Top 10 Raspberry Pi Project idea’s that you can start right now


Here the Top 10 Best Raspberry Pi Project idea’s that you can start right now

The Raspberry Pi is a low cost, credit-card sized computer that plugs into a computer monitor or TV, and uses a standard keyboard and mouse. It is a capable little device that enables people of all ages to explore computing and to learn how to program in languages like Scratch and Python. It’s capable of doing everything you’d expect a desktop computer to do, from browsing the internet and playing high-definition video, to making spreadsheets, word-processing, and playing games.

The Raspberry Pi has the ability to interact with the outside world and has been used in a wide array of digital maker projects, from music machines and parent detectors to weather stations and tweeting birdhouses with infra-red cameras. So in this article, we are going to list 10 Project idea’s with the source code that you can use for collage projects, DIYs, and much more.

You can order a Raspberry Pi 4 model on Flipkart from here

You can also order Raspberry pi on Amazon

Top 10 Best Raspberry Pi Project Idea’s with source code

  1. Home Automation System
  2. Building a Smart TV
  3. Building legit Desktop Computer
  4. Build An AI Assistant
  5. Motion Capture Security System
  6. FM Radio Station
  7. Wireless Print Server
  8. Make a Pi Twitter Bot
  9. Minecraft Game Server
  10. Time Lapse Camera

Home Automation System

A home automation project is arguably one of the best Raspberry Pi projects for senior developers. All those skills and experiences that you have been gaining all these years will come together to automate your home appliances and will make your friends drop their jaws at the same time. You can handle such home automation raspberry pi projects in numerous ways. Adding an Arduino board may accelerate further power to the system.


  • You need to set up a Relay Circuit for your Raspberry first.
  • Use the GPIO pin no. 6 of your pi board for connecting the relay circuit.
  • Make smart use of protocols like MQTT and APIs of thingspeak for connecting a large number of devices and sensors.

You can read the full guide and source code from here

Building a Smart TV

Did you know that getting a smart TV doesn’t necessarily mean you’ve to go bankrupt? Any old PC monitor and a Raspberry Pi computer are all that you’ll need to build one of your own. This is definitely among the best Raspberry Pi projects for improving your home entertainment system. We highly suggest you take on such raspberry pi projects if you’ve got an extra piece of monitor lying around idly.


  • You will need to utilize the OMX image viewer software for such raspberry projects.
  • Install the libjepg8-dev and libpng12-dev module into your pi.
  • You can set up Kodi for further improvements in your Smart TV project.

Get the source code and complete guide from here

Building legit Desktop Computer

Getting a full-fledged desktop computer out of a cheap Rasberry Pi should ring excitement bells in your ears. It is arguably one of the best raspberry pi projects for system enthusiasts as they will gain first-hand experience on how to build a system from almost ground zero. If you have a keen interest in raspberry pi projects involving computing, we recommend you check this project right now.


  • Connect an HDMI monitor for being used as a display to your Pi.
  • Add the necessary peripheral devices, namely keyboard, and mouse.
  • Shift your board inside a solid metal case for safety.
  • Install a cooler to take the heat off of your raspberry pi board.

Get the source code and full guide from here

Build An AI Assistant

It’s the age of AI, and we all are swarmed away with the number of mesmerizing open-source AI projects getting in the market every day. If you also want to try your hand in the field of AI, building an AI assistant can be one of the best Raspberry Pi projects that you can take on right now. You will utilize the Google Assistant and the Google Cloud SDK for such raspberry pi projects.


  • Register a free account for the Google Assistant through the Google Console Actions dashboard.
  • Set up and configure audio for your Google Assistant account.
  • Your Raspberry Pi needs to be authorized for the Google Assistant.
  • Set up Google Assistant to autostart at boot time on your Pi.

Get the source code and project guide from here

Motion Capture Security System

For your next raspberry projects, consider building an HD camera surveillance system that captures live video whenever something moves in the monitored area. You can use the same Pi camera you used for the time-lapse project or might opt-in for a more powerful one. This is one of the best raspberry pi projects for you if you want to check on your dog or the driveaway while on vacation very conveniently.


  • You should be able to live stream from any web browser or mobile device.
  • The camera should be able to record motion into a video file on demand.
  • We recommend you use the Raspberry Pi Camera Module for such Rasberry pi projects.
  • Use this motion detection software to configure the motion capture functionality.
  • For additional challenges, make your motion camera to send out a notification whenever it captures certain images or videos.

Download the complete guide and source code from here

FM Radio Station

Did you know, you can very quickly turn that old Raspberry board of yours into a cutting-edge FM radio station? All you’ll need is a working internet connection and a microphone! This is definitely among the best Raspberry Pi projects for us music enthusiasts. Plus you will learn valuable concepts to use in advanced raspberry pi projects later.


  • You will use the SCSS(Spread Spectrum Clock Signal), the default EMI suppression tool used in the Raspberry Pi to transmit radio signals.
  • Utilize the GPIO pin 4 of your Raspberry Pi to send the transmissions using a wire as an antenna.
  • Use this program by downloading, and compiling to convert your Raspberry Pi into the FM station.
  • If looking for an additional challenge, customize your FM station raspberry pi projects in a way that it can broadcast live.

Download the complete guide and source code from here

Wireless Print Server

Have an old unused printer in the basement? You can clean it up today and make a wireless print server out of it. All you’ll need is a Rasberry Pi board, a storage space, and some will. It is one of the best Raspberry Pi projects for students trying to build some quick raspberry projects. The print server can be accessed from any device that you interface for and will provide a useful means to do that quick office work.


  • We recommend the Raspberry Pi 3 for this project as it comes with built-in wireless support. However, you can use a WiFi dongle for utilizing previous boards.
  • You will use the CUPS (Common Unix Printing System) software for running the print server.
  • Use Samba for allowing Windows devices to use your Raspberry Pi print server.
  • Connect a printer to the system, and you’re ready for some printing.

Download and get the source code and complete guide of the project from here.

Make a Pi Twitter Bot

Twitter, one of the largest social media platforms, lets developers create a real-time twitter bot through their API. This is among the most anticipated raspberry pi projects for open-source enthusiasts. If you like the idea of having your personal twitter bot, then this is definitely in the list of best raspberry pi projects for you.


  • The bot is, in essence, a web application, built and run on a Rasberry Pi board.
  • You will have to register a twitter application by going to the Twitter APIs.
  • You need to set up and write the bot on your Raspberry Pi using the Python programming language; the Twython library is heavily recommended for the API bit.
  • You can automate the bot and make it upload the CPU temperature of your Raspberry Pi whenever it reaches a certain threshold temperature.

Download the source code and complete guide of the project from here

Minecraft Game Server

It is one of the best Raspberry Pi projects for you if you are a fan of the online sandbox game. Minecraft, since its release, has become a household name and is one of the top gaming projects of Microsoft today. Raspberry comes with a dedicated Pi version of this fantastic game, which you can leverage to build your own Minecraft server raspberry pi projects. For this project, you’ll only require a working Pi board and a fast LAN cable.


  • Your system needs to be up to date before proceeding with Minecraft installation.
  • The Java runtime and build tools are required to run the game on your Pi.
  • Launch the server and connect to it from another computer on the home network to test your work.

Get the complete guide and source code of the project from here

Time Lapse Camera

If you’re an avid photographic lover like me, building a time-lapse camera can be one of the best Raspberry Pi projects for your endeavor. You can build time-lapse raspberry projects easily by utilizing the Blinkt addon of your Raspberry Pi board. The camera can be attached to a wearable item, thus allowing you to see for yourself what the camera is seeing. This quick little project is one of the best raspberry pi projects to show off your Pi skills.


  • You will require either a Pi Camera or a Pi NoIR Camera along with a compatible cable and a pie board for this project.
  • Attach the camera to your Pi board and check if it’s working correctly, your camera might need to be enabled first.
  • Use this Python program to code the time-lapse portion of your project.

Get the source code and guide of the project from here.


About Author

Be Ready for the challenge

Notify of
Inline Feedbacks
View all comments